Father jailed 20 years for incest involving 17-year-old daughter

The Circuit Court in Lawra has sentenced a 47-year-old man, Kwame Ti-Zaaelcuu, to 20 years’ imprisonment for incest after he was found guilty of sexually abusing his 17-year-old biological daughter over an extended period.

The convict was also sentenced to 10 years’ imprisonment for threatening the life of the survivor, with both sentences to run concurrently in hard labour.

The conviction followed investigations and prosecution by the Lawra District Police Command after a complaint was lodged against the convict, leading to the establishment of the offences.

According to the Upper West Regional Police Command, the investigations revealed that the convict abused his daughter, a Junior High School student, while allegedly threatening to kill her if she disclosed the abuse to anyone.

The Court, presided over by His Honour Stanley Adjei, delivered the verdict on Friday, July 24, 2026, after a full trial and found Kwame Ti-Zaaelcuu guilty of incest and threat of death.

In addition to the custodial sentence, the court directed the Department of Social Welfare in Lawra to provide counselling and psychosocial support for the survivor.

The Upper West Regional Police Command commended the investigators and prosecutor for their professionalism and commitment, which led to the successful prosecution of the case.

The Command has also encouraged the public to promptly report all forms of sexual and domestic abuse to the Police to ensure that perpetrators are brought to justice and survivors receive the needed support.
